Introduction

A heavy barbell is an indispensable tool for anyone serious about strength training and fitness. Whether you're a seasoned athlete or a beginner, incorporating a heavy barbell into your workout routine can provide numerous benefits. When you use a heavy barbell, you engage multiple muscle groups, promoting overall strength and muscle growth. This versatile equipment can be used for various exercises, including squats, deadlifts, and bench presses, making it a staple in gyms worldwide.

Using a heavy barbell not only helps in building muscle but also enhances your core stability and improves your posture. As you lift heavier weights, your body adapts, leading to increased strength and endurance over time. It's important to ensure that you use proper form to prevent injuries and maximize your workout efficiency.

Here are some key benefits of using a heavy barbell:
  • Increases muscle mass and strength
  • Improves functional fitness
  • Enhances core stability
  • Boosts metabolism
  • Can be used for a variety of exercises
To get the most out of your heavy barbell workouts, consider starting with lighter weights to master your form before progressing to heavier loads. Additionally, always consult with a fitness professional if you're unsure about your technique or how to incorporate a heavy barbell into your routine. Remember, safety first! With consistent training and commitment, you'll see significant improvements in your strength and overall fitness levels.

FAQs

How can I choose the best heavy barbell for my needs?

When selecting a heavy barbell, consider factors such as your strength level, the types of exercises you'll be performing, and the weight capacity. Look for a barbell that is durable and has a good grip for safety.

What are the key features to look for when selecting a heavy barbell?

Key features include the barbell's weight capacity, diameter, grip texture, and material. Ensure the barbell is designed for the type of lifting you plan to do, such as Olympic lifting or powerlifting.

Are there any common mistakes people make when purchasing a heavy barbell?

Common mistakes include choosing a barbell that is too heavy for their current strength level, not considering the barbell's grip and comfort, or neglecting to check for quality and durability.

How often should I use a heavy barbell in my workout routine?

Incorporating a heavy barbell 2-3 times a week into your strength training routine can be effective. Ensure to allow adequate recovery time between sessions.

What safety tips should I follow when using a heavy barbell?

Always use proper form, start with lighter weights to master your technique, and consider using a spotter or safety equipment. Warming up before lifting is also crucial to prevent injuries.
